Rainforests play a crucial role in the water cycle by pulling water from underground and releasing it into the atmosphere. They are responsible for producing about 20% of the world's freshwater, highlighting their global importance. However, if deforestation continues at the current rate, rainforests could disappear in as little as 100 years, posing a significant threat to the planet's water resources.
